Khavo had always been the friendly type. When she was young, she used to walk up to the most random of people on Rigel, trying to make friends with them. Of course, this mechanism of going about life didn’t always work out, but sometimes she got the satisfaction of making someone smile. Although those days were long behind her, perhaps further than she cared to admit, Khavo never passed up the opportunity of a new friendship. Especially if the person was at least half as weird as she was.

Around 20:20hrs, give or take five minutes, Khavo found herself in front of Gong’da’s quarters, toes outstretched as she tried to verify she had the right place. Cursing her height, she reached up to press the chime, wondering if her tardiness would cause a problem. Unfortunately for Khavo, finding Gong’da’s quarters had been far more difficult than she anticipated. Shrugging off the possibility, Khavo rocked between her heel and toe, waiting for the doc to answer the door.
